Как добавить некоторые специфические загрузчики в мой файл webpack.config.js
Я хочу добавить image-webpack-loader, file-loader и url-loader в мой файл webpack.config.js Вот мой файл webpack.config.js:
const path = require("path");
const webpack = require("webpack");
module.exports = {
entry: "./src/index.js",
output: {
path: path.resolve(__dirname, "./static/frontend"),
filename: "[name].js",
},
module: {
rules: [
{
test: /\.js$/,
exclude: /node_modules/,
use: {
loader: "babel-loader",
},
},
//additional configuration to handle *.ccs files
{
test: /\.css$/i,
use: ["style-loader", "css-loader"],
},
{
test: /\.(png|jpg|jpeg|gif|svg|eot|ttf|woff|woff2)$/,
loader: "url-loader",
options: {
limit: 10000,
},
},
{
test: /\.json$/,
use: [
{
loader: "file-loader",
options: {
name: "data/[name].[ext]",
},
},
],
},//end loader
],
},
optimization: {
minimize: true,
},
plugins: [
new webpack.DefinePlugin({
"process.env": {
// This has effect on the react lib size
NODE_ENV: JSON.stringify("production"),
},
}),
],
};
Я попробовал эту конфигурацию, скажите мне, правильно ли это или какие изменения я должен сделать для этого...